Winners

Losers

Sergio Vitale

The Republican flexed his fundraising abilities by hosting a $30,000 fundraiser for state Sen. Andy Harris.

Republican Party

Delegate Rick Weldon's switch from Republican to independent is not a good omen.

Barack Obama

Steph Colbert would ask: Great week or greatest week ever? Either way, his campaign is looking pretty good right now.

Steny Hoyer

House leaders faced an embarrassing setback earlier this week when they failed to get enough votes to pass the Wall Street bailout legislation.

Ned Cheston

He was recently hired as the legislative director for Howard County Executive Ken Ulman.

Sheila Dixon

It's not dead yet. The probe involving the Baltimore mayor continues.

Hoyer is a “Winner” and should be Speaker


The Boys over at Politicker totally missed the Herculean effort of Steny Hoyer in the passage of the bailout provision. He did well to get this bill through Congress in one week having been saddled with Nancy Pelosi’s un-Speaker-like partisan prattle while attempting to reach consensus with the Liberal and Blue Dog holdouts on his home team and Club for Growth Republicans across the aisle trying to maintain some shred of dignity.

The Leader wanted this bailout plan to pass with a clear majority, which he got in the end with a 263-171 vote, 60 percent of the House and a number of Republican crossovers. This legislative feat once again demonstrates why the Democratic Caucus should elect the Leader as the Speaker when the new Congress convenes in January (hopefully with an additional member in the form of Frank Kratovil from MD-1).

Hoyer is a Big Winner this week.
